Teachable features and specs

  • Ease of Use
    Teachable offers a user-friendly interface that allows users to create and manage online courses without needing any technical knowledge.
  • Customization
    Teachable provides a variety of customization options for course creators to tailor the look and feel of their courses and sales pages.
  • Integrated Payment Processing
    Teachable simplifies the process of monetizing courses by offering integrated payment processing with support for multiple currencies.
  • Analytics and Reporting
    Users have access to comprehensive analytics and reporting tools to track student engagement, sales, and overall course performance.
  • Marketing Tools
    Teachable includes built-in marketing tools such as affiliate programs, coupon codes, and email marketing integrations to help creators promote their courses.
  • Security and Hosting
    Teachable handles the hosting and security of online courses, ensuring that content is protected and accessible to students 24/7.
  • Multiple Content Formats
    Users can incorporate various types of content into their courses, including videos, quizzes, assignments, and downloadable resources.

Possible disadvantages of Teachable

  • Pricing
    Teachable's pricing plans can be expensive, especially for smaller course creators or those just starting out.
  • Transaction Fees
    Lower-tier plans come with transaction fees, which can cut into the earnings of course creators.
  • Limited Advanced Customization
    While Teachable offers some customization options, advanced users may find the customization capabilities limited compared to self-hosted platforms.
  • Email Support
    Customer support is primarily provided via email, which can result in slower response times compared to live chat or phone support.
  • Lack of Community Features
    Teachable does not offer robust community features, such as forums or social media-like interaction, which can enhance student engagement.
  • Learning Curve for Advanced Features
    Although the platform is user-friendly, some advanced features may have a steeper learning curve for users who are not tech-savvy.
  • Dependence on Platform
    Course creators are dependent on Teachable for hosting and managing their content, meaning any issues with the platform can affect their courses.

QPython 3L features and specs

  • Ease of Use
    QPython 3L provides an intuitive interface and does not require complicated setup, making it convenient for beginners to start programming on Android devices.
  • Portable Python Development
    It offers the ability to write and run Python scripts directly on Android devices, allowing for development on the go without the need for a full computer setup.
  • Large Standard Library
    QPython 3L supports a wide range of Python standard libraries, enabling users to perform various tasks without needing to install additional modules.
  • Community Support
    There is a robust community of QPython users and developers who share knowledge, tutorials, and scripts that can help newcomers and seasoned developers alike.
  • Integration with SL4A
    Integration with the Scripting Layer for Android (SL4A) allows QPython scripts to directly interact with Android features, expanding its capabilities beyond typical Python execution.

Possible disadvantages of QPython 3L

  • Performance Limitations
    Running Python scripts on Android devices can be slower compared to running them on a PC due to hardware limitations and the interpreter environment.
  • Limited Third-Party Library Support
    Not all third-party Python libraries are compatible or available for installation on QPython, which can restrict the functionality for certain applications.
  • Platform Constraints
    As QPython 3L is designed for Android, it may not utilize the full potential of Python on desktop platforms and lacks cross-platform integration features.
  • User Interface Limitations
    Developing complex graphical user interfaces can be challenging due to limited support for GUI frameworks compared to desktop Python environments.
  • Dependency Management
    Handling dependencies and package management can be more cumbersome on QPython than in standard Python environments like Anaconda or virtualenv on PC.
